Maggie is a sweet, loyal, loving Husky/Australian Shepherd mix. She loves to run, cuddle, swim, roll around, fetch, walk, go on car rides (short or long), eat peanut butter, cuddle and play with her toys, meet new people, play in the snow, please her family, and give kisses. She loves squeaky toys and balls, will tear up stuffed toys and love them better once un-stuffed. She loves pig ears and She has the personality of a dramatic Husky and the facial expressions of an Aussie. She is high energy when she is awake but also enjoys her naps in the shade or curled up inside. She is muzzle and crate trained, although she has separation anxiety so some days are better than others in her crate. She would do best with a family that can spend a lot of time with her by being at home, taking her with them, or enrolling her in a daycare program so that she is not home alone for long. A completely enclosed crate is best for Maggie as one of her nicknames is Houdini and can escape metal barred crates in search for her family. She is house trained and trained on basic commands such as sit, down, stay, come, leave it, and more. She walks well on a leash. She is a runner, so a fenced yard is best for her. She has anxiety with loud noises such as fireworks and storms and takes a combination of two medications to help her. She does well with all ages and genders of people. She does not do well with cats or other small animals. She does well with dogs, but must live with other pets that are her size or larger only because she is easily jealous of other dogs, so she needs to be with other dogs that can show dominance.
